Considering the site and the issue of paid blogging, I have come across the issue of disclosure.

Having written previously on getting paid for blogging, I found this site and thought I would mentally work on a disclosure policy. What should I disclose to people who are visiting my blog? Well, after looking at my about page you can pretty much see where I am coming from. I am a Christian who works with teens and cares about how to help them and the people who work with them. If you think that anything that I do is without motive, then you probably are an idiot. If you think that I would sell out my beliefs just to make a buck, then you don’t know me or normal salaries for youth ministry positions. If you think that I would not take money for my opinion just because it might make some people question wonder if I was really into it, then you just don’t know me and my opinion doesn’t really matter then.

So do I need a disclosure statement?
